The Mole host Anderson Cooper had “full” control of what he says.

The Mole host Anderson Cooper had “full” control of what he says.
Unlike Julie “Scripted” Chen, Anderson Cooper says he had control over his lines as host of ABC’s upcoming The Mole. Unlike Julie Chen’s “hokey lines,” “I had full say over what I was saying,” he told the Philadelphia Daily News.
